mp3gain back end 1.0.7

http://www.geocities.com/mp3gain

Tiny update that won't affect most people. The previous update allowed you to tell mp3gain "I don't care if you think this is an mp2 or mp1 file. I'm telling you that this is an mp3 file, so process it even if you think it's not an mp3 file."

Now I've fixed the code so there's a much smaller chance that it will mis-identify a slightly corrupt mp3 file as an mp2 file.
